General

Highly-sought developmental big from Canada who committed to Georgia Tech in early August after reclassifying to the 2022 class … Enrolled for the fall semester and was eligible immediately as a freshman … Chose the Yellow Jackets over Missouri, Northwestern and Wisconsin … Transferred out after the 2022-23 season … Rated a three-star prospect by On3 and 247Sports … Born in Mississauga, Ontario, is the middle of three children … His mother, Irina, played for the Russian junior national team … Enjoys weight lifting … Name pronounced “KEER-ul MAR-tin-off” … Intends to study business administration.

2022-23 (freshman)

Played briefly in seven games (Clayton State, North Alabama, Northeastern, Alabama State, Duke, Florida Tech, at Syracuse)

High School

Attended the Lawrenceville School in Lawrenceville, N.J., in 2021-22, where he played for coach Doug Davis … Lawrenceville (rated the sixth-best academic school in the nation) competes in the high-level Mid-Atlantic Prep League … Made the school’s Dean’s list two of three terms … Prior to that, attended and played basketball at Innisdale Secondary School for three years, and graduated from that school.

Club basketball

Member of the UPlay Canada team on the Nike EYBL circuit in the spring and summer of 2022, averaging 14.0 points and 9.4 rebounds over the length of the schedule … Scored in double figures across five games, with a personal tournament-high of 27 against Vegas Elite, and averaged 17.2 points and 10.4 rebounds on the final weekend in Kansas City.

International Basketball

Invited to play with the Canadian Junior National Team and is part of the Canadian Junior National program.

Cyril says: “The reason I chose Georgia Tech was because of all of the boxes that it checked off,” Martynov said to On3. “The level of basketball, academics, and development that the program offers is at a very high level which is really important for me when choosing my school. The coaches and staff were also incredible. I can see myself working with them for the time coming, which brought me to make this decision!”
